.page.svelte-1uha8ag{background:#fff8f0;min-height:100vh;font-family:-apple-system,BlinkMacSystemFont,Segoe UI,Roboto,Oxygen,Ubuntu,Cantarell,sans-serif}.modal-overlay.svelte-1uha8ag{z-index:1000;background:#000000b3;justify-content:center;align-items:center;padding:20px;animation:.3s svelte-1uha8ag-fadeIn;display:flex;position:fixed;inset:0}@keyframes svelte-1uha8ag-fadeIn{0%{opacity:0}to{opacity:1}}.modal.svelte-1uha8ag{background:#fff;border-radius:24px;width:100%;max-width:500px;max-height:90vh;padding:40px 30px;animation:.3s svelte-1uha8ag-slideUp;overflow-y:auto;box-shadow:0 20px 60px #00000080}@keyframes svelte-1uha8ag-slideUp{0%{opacity:0;transform:translateY(50px)}to{opacity:1;transform:translateY(0)}}.modal-header.svelte-1uha8ag{text-align:center;margin-bottom:32px}.modal-header.svelte-1uha8ag h2:where(.svelte-1uha8ag){color:#1a1a1a;margin:0 0 12px;font-size:28px;font-weight:700}.modal-header.svelte-1uha8ag p:where(.svelte-1uha8ag){color:#666;margin:0;font-size:16px}.benefits.svelte-1uha8ag{grid-template-columns:1fr 1fr;gap:16px;margin-bottom:32px;display:grid}.benefit.svelte-1uha8ag{text-align:center;background:linear-gradient(135deg,#ff6b35 0%,#ff8c61 100%);border-radius:16px;flex-direction:column;align-items:center;padding:20px 16px;transition:transform .2s;display:flex}.benefit.svelte-1uha8ag:hover{transform:translateY(-4px)}.icon.svelte-1uha8ag{margin-bottom:12px;font-size:48px}.text.svelte-1uha8ag h3:where(.svelte-1uha8ag){color:#1a1a1a;margin:0 0 4px;font-size:15px;font-weight:600}.text.svelte-1uha8ag p:where(.svelte-1uha8ag){color:#666;margin:0;font-size:13px;line-height:1.4}.ios-instructions.svelte-1uha8ag{background:#fff3cd;border:1px solid #ffc107;border-radius:12px;margin-bottom:24px;padding:16px;font-size:14px}.ios-instructions.svelte-1uha8ag p:where(.svelte-1uha8ag){color:#856404;margin:0 0 8px;font-weight:600}.ios-instructions.svelte-1uha8ag ol:where(.svelte-1uha8ag){color:#856404;margin:0;padding-left:20px}.ios-instructions.svelte-1uha8ag li:where(.svelte-1uha8ag){margin:4px 0;line-height:1.5}.share-icon.svelte-1uha8ag{color:#fff;background:#007aff;border-radius:4px;padding:2px 6px;font-size:11px;display:inline-block}.actions.svelte-1uha8ag{flex-direction:column;gap:12px;display:flex}.install-btn.svelte-1uha8ag{color:#fff;cursor:pointer;background:#fff8f0;border:none;border-radius:16px;width:100%;padding:18px 24px;font-size:18px;font-weight:700;transition:transform .2s,box-shadow .2s;box-shadow:0 6px 20px #667eea66}.install-btn.svelte-1uha8ag:hover:not(:disabled){transform:translateY(-2px);box-shadow:0 8px 30px #667eea99}.install-btn.svelte-1uha8ag:disabled{opacity:.7;cursor:not-allowed}.skip-btn.svelte-1uha8ag{color:#999;cursor:pointer;background:0 0;border:none;width:100%;padding:12px 24px;font-size:14px;font-weight:500;transition:color .2s}.skip-btn.svelte-1uha8ag:hover{color:#333}@media (width<=480px){.modal.svelte-1uha8ag{padding:30px 20px}.modal-header.svelte-1uha8ag h2:where(.svelte-1uha8ag){font-size:24px}.benefits.svelte-1uha8ag{grid-template-columns:1fr;gap:12px}.benefit.svelte-1uha8ag{padding:16px}.icon.svelte-1uha8ag{font-size:40px}}
